NICE — Firefighters responded to a series of small fires early Thursday morning on the Robinson Rancheria reservation. The first call came at around 1:40 a.m. for the largest fire, which burned less than one-quarter acre, while two more spot fires were reported shortly thereafter, according to Northshore Fire Protection District (NFPD) chief Jay Beristianos.
Two NFPD units and one CAL FIRE unit responded. No injuries or property damage occurred because of the fires. Beristianos said all three fires were intentionally set and the incidents remain under investigation by CAL FIRE.
